Tatiana Shanina

Шанина Tatiana Shanina was born in Kishinev (Moldova). She graduated from the Moscow State Conservatory (classes of Professor Elizaveta Gilels). Since 1979, she taught at a lyceum and worked as a violinist of the Belarusian State Philharmonic Orchestra. In 1982-1992 she was a member of the State Symphony Orchestra of the USSR Ministry of Culture under Gennady Rozhdestvensky, in 1992-2003 she worked at the Academic Symphony Orchestra of the Moscow State Philharmonic Society. Since 2003 she has been a member of the National Philharmonic Orchestra of Russia. She is an “Honored Artist of the Russian Federation”.
